UNITED STATES v. JOHNSON

No. 72-1537 Summary Calendar.

464 F.2d 556 (1972)

UNITED STATES of America,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Johnny Frank JOHNSON, Defendant-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it.

August 1, 1972.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ard Wayne Grant, Marianna, Fla. (Court-appointed), for defendant-appellant.

William H. Stafford, Jr., U. S. Atty., Pensacola, Fla., Clinton Ashmore, Asst. U. S. Atty., Tallahassee, Fla., for plaintiff-appellee.

Before WISDOM, GODBOLD and RONEY, Circuit Judges.


PER CURIAM:

The appellant Johnny Frank Johnson was tried, convicted, and sentenced to three years' imprisonment on February 28, 1972 on a count of uttering and publishing a United States Treasury check with a forged endorsement in violation of 18 U.S.C. § 495. On this appeal Johnson contends that the trial court erred in denying his motions for acquittal, alleging that the evidence presented by the government was insufficient to convict.
